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
827033 244 3147496 314427204
926908 4156
926908 4156
2159 2104273086 607 166 1131
All about undefined
Interested in learning more?
926908 4156
2159 2104273086 607 166 1131
See more
365 80071
43229022314 0595236 72 57556 74
See more
7584145 39201952 13095449096
8418 6412 4315
See more